If you plan on getting your bachelor's degree in hospitality management, you won't be alone since the degree program is ranked #49 in the country in terms of popularity. As a result, there are many college that offer the degree, making your choice of school a hard one.

In 2024, College Factual analyzed 5 schools in order to identify the top ones for its Best Hospitality Management Bachelor's Degree Schools in Alabama ranking. When you put them all together, these colleges and universities awarded 264 bachelor's degrees in hospitality management during the 2020-2021 academic year.

A Great Overall School

The overall quality of a bachelor's degree school is important to ensure a good education, not just how well they do in a particular major. To take this into account we include a college's overall Best Colleges ranking which itself looks at a combination of different factors like degree completion, educational resources, student body caliber and post-graduation earnings for the school as a whole.

Early-Career Earnings

One measure we use to determine the quality of a school is to look at the average salary of bachelor's graduates during the early years of their career. That is, everyone wants their bachelor's degree to be worth something, and salaries are one measure of determining that.

The University of Alabama is one of the finest schools in the country for getting a bachelor's degree in hospitality management. UA is a fairly large public university located in the city of Tuscaloosa.

Bachelor's students who receive their degree from the hospitality program earn an average of $33,886 in the first couple years of their career.

It is hard to beat Auburn University if you want to pursue a bachelor's degree in hospitality management. Located in the small city of Auburn, Auburn is a public university with a very large student population.

Those hospitality management students who get their bachelor's degree from Auburn University earn $7,342 more than the typical hospitality student.
